Output 39d7a63c73c96314774af9d566a45cf3c2e81fd6f34d15a2385976d68f8c4e7f:0

value
1317560
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5a90b727c12aab4aea69e9077ea5125d29c847f9 OP_EQUAL
address
39wt6pBRFP2ko9Jm869RwDdFdge6g1iUMR
transaction
39d7a63c73c96314774af9d566a45cf3c2e81fd6f34d15a2385976d68f8c4e7f
spent
true